Key Takeaways
The Roomba 960 takes approximately 2 to 3 hours to fully charge, depending on the current battery level and the charging conditions. Once fully charged, it can operate for up to 75 minutes before needing to be recharged.

Optimal Charging Practices For Roomba 960

To maximize the charging efficiency of your Roomba 960, it’s important to understand and implement optimal charging practices. Firstly, it’s recommended to place the Home Base (charging station) in an open area that is easily accessible to the Roomba. Avoid placing the Home Base in an enclosed space or behind furniture to ensure the Roomba can dock and charge properly. Additionally, always ensure the Home Base is connected to a power source and the Roomba is returned to the base after each cleaning cycle. This allows the Roomba to automatically recharge, ensuring it’s always ready to tackle the next cleaning session.

Furthermore, it’s important to regularly clean the Roomba’s charging contacts and the Home Base’s charging points to remove any dust, dirt, or debris that may hinder the charging process. This simple maintenance practice can help ensure a consistent and reliable charging experience. Troubleshooting Common Charging Issues

In the event that your Roomba 960 is experiencing charging issues, there are a few common troubleshooting steps that you can take to rectify the situation. Check the power source first to ensure that the charging dock is properly plugged in and receiving power. If the dock seems to be in order, inspect the charging contacts on both the robot and the dock for any debris or obstruction that may be preventing a solid connection during charging.

Additionally, it’s important to confirm that the robot is properly seated on the charging dock and that there are no physical barriers preventing it from making proper contact. If the issue persists, consider resetting the robot by powering it off and on again, and also ensuring that the battery contacts are clean and free from any dirt or grime. If these steps do not resolve the charging problem, it may be necessary to contact customer support for further assistance.
